When your provider's access token (not the [session token](#extend-session-token-expiration-grace-period)) expires, you need to reauthenticate the user before you use that token again. You can avoid token expiration by making a `GET` call to the `/.auth/refresh` endpoint of your application. When called, App Service automatically refreshes the access tokens in the [token store](overview-authentication-authorization.md#token-store) for the authenticated user. Subsequent requests for tokens by your app code get the refreshed tokens. However, for token refresh to work, the token store must contain [refresh tokens](/entra/identity-platform/refresh-tokens) for your provider. The way to get refresh tokens are documented by each provider, but the following list is a brief summary:
